Government Orders

Government Orders

A bill to create a new Crown corporation called Build Canada Homes to promote and support the supply of affordable housing in Canada. The debates focused on whether creating another bureaucracy is the right approach, with Conservatives questioning the need for a third federal Crown corporation and suggesting it may become another Ottawa bureaucracy. Liberals emphasized the importance of collaboration and providing financial tools to build affordable housing quickly and efficiently. Some concerns were raised about the affordability measurement and the need for varied housing types.
